The Effect of Salinity and Magnetic Water on Yield and Water Use Efficiency of Cumin (Case Study: Kashmar Region)

Abstract:
In order to study the effect of magnetic field and different levels of saline irrigation water on cumin yield, a factorial experiment with a completely randomized block design with three replications was carried out in Kashmar Higher Education Institute in 2016. In this experiment, four salinity levels of irrigation water; 0.5 (S1) as control, 6 (S2), 8 (S3), and (S4) 10 dS m-1, and two levels of magnetic field; magnetic water (M1) and non-magnetic water (M2) Were used. The results showed that the magnetized water increased the yield of cumin compared with non-magnetized water. So that the maximum grain yield of cumin (1085 kg. ha-1) was corresponded to S1M1 treatment and the lowest one (530 kg ha-1) was corresponded toS4M2 treatment. Also, the maximum and the minimum biological yields (2215 and 1295 kg ha-1) were corresponded to the same treatments (S1M1 and S4M2) respectively. The yield reduction rates for 6, 8 and 10 dS m-1 saline waters were calculated to be 7.8, 14.7 and 32%, respectively for the magnetic field and 6, 15.7 and 44.5%, respectively for the non-magnetic field as compared to the control treatment. In addition, the average water use efficiencies of saline and magnetic water treatments (0.5, 6, 8 and 10 dS m-1) were estimated to be 8.8, 6.5, 10.3 and 17.4% greater than the ones of saline and non-magnetic water treatments, respectively. Therefore, the use of magnetic water can increase the yield of cumin under salt stress conditions.
